Output 53544d21b2f9538e3ad8575b6a99f5ed4a31f79b9c70c65e397d87d56e9d6bf2:0

value
1463930794
script pubkey
OP_0 OP_PUSHBYTES_20 ae8818872cf41435fe328bce118dd8fc69ccda85
address
bc1q46yp3pev7s2rtl3j308prrwcl35uek59uv7xvw
transaction
53544d21b2f9538e3ad8575b6a99f5ed4a31f79b9c70c65e397d87d56e9d6bf2
confirmations
362883
spent
true